I use a $100 condenser mic for recording which is among the cheapest out there when it comes to those type mics. Not sure of the brand right now I'm not at home but you can see it in the corner of the videos. I use a Blue Microphones interface plugged an old laptop and sync the audio to the video afterwards. Like anything it takes time and just experimentation to learn the best placement and setup. I record these where I do because I want a bit of the room echo in there.
